The Millbridge North Road Federation
The Millbridge north road federations second old bird classic race to report on was being flown from Elgin City in Murray north Scotland were the birds were jointly liberated with the new north road amalgamations birds and international championship club birds on the 22/6/24 at 8am into a west south west wind.

The top twelve in the federation are as follows with yet another Harty win with their superb on form cock was S Speight & Son flying 277 miles this was another hot pot performance from the family of Butchers claiming 1st and 6th federation their winner a 1y chequer pied cock being a Sticker Donker crossed Gus Jansen he's 2x 1st federations and a string of club cards this season for the partnership he was bred by Ross Thackeray for the partnership their second to clock a 1y blue cock being a son off the partnerships RPRA award winner when paired to a Eddie Bateman hen both were widowhood flown with velocities of 1359 and 1310.

2nd, 3rd and 9th federation was Paul & Gary Cooper flying 279 miles all three birds for the brothers are of Herman Cuesters bred from out their stock loft the first a 2y blue cock that's carded on the south road for the brothers before switching north road now he's carding on the north the next a 1y blue hen followed by a 2y blue cock all were flown on the widowhood system with velocities of 1333, 1324 and 1304.
4th, 5th and 8th federation was the forever present Ronnie Kitching flying 279 miles his first a 2y red chequer cock followed by a 1y red chequer pied cock then a 1y blue cock all three being Stefan Lambrechts flown on the widowhood system with the two red cocks arriving together with velocities of 2 x 1316 and the third on 1302.
7th, 8th and 11th federation was the Castello family & Leach flying 280 miles with their round about system flown own Castello family strain of birds crossed Leach Brothers Van Den Bulks their first with also two arriving together a 1y chequer pied hen followed by 2y blue cock and then a 1y blue hen with velocities of 2x 1309 and 1296.
12th federation was Peter Smith flying 289 miles with a 1y chequer hen being a Richard Van Hoots of Belgium crossed a Harry Crowder bird on the natural system with a velocity of 1289.
